¿Cuánto cuesta alquilar un apartamento en Pulaski County?
| Dormitorios | Precio Promedio | Más barato | Más caro |
|---|---|---|---|
| Apartamentos 1 Dormitorios en Pulaski County | $966 | $850 | $1,150 |
| Apartamentos 2 Dormitorios en Pulaski County | $1,140 | $995 | $1,350 |
| Apartamentos 3 Dormitorios en Pulaski County | $1,306 | $1,055 | $1,500 |

¿Cuánto cuesta alquilar un apartamento de dos dormitorios en Pulaski County?
El precio mensual de alquiler de Apartamentos 2 Dormitorios disponibles en Pulaski County van desde $995 hasta $1,350. Actualmente el precio medio de un alquiler de dos dormitorios aquí es de $1,140
